轉移費用擴展
TransferFee 擴展是一個 Mint 擴展,允許創建者設置一個「稅」,每當有人進行交換時都會收取該稅。
為了確保費用接收者在每次有人進行交換時不會被寫鎖,並確保我們可以並行處理包含此擴展的 Mint 的交易,費用會被存放在接收者的代幣帳戶中,只有 Withdraw Authority 可以提取。
初始化鑄幣帳戶
由於 Anchor 沒有任何用於 transfer_fee 擴展的宏,我們將使用原始 CPI 創建一個 Mint 帳戶。
以下是如何使用轉移費用擴展創建鑄幣的方法:
use anchor_lang::prelude::*;
use anchor_lang::system_program::{create_account, CreateAccount};
use anchor_spl::{
token_2022::{
initialize_mint2,
spl_token_2022::{
extension::{
transfer_fee::TransferFeeConfig, BaseStateWithExtensions, ExtensionType,
StateWithExtensions,
},
pod::PodMint,
state::Mint as MintState,
},
InitializeMint2,
},
token_interface::{
spl_pod::optional_keys::OptionalNonZeroPubkey, transfer_fee_initialize, Token2022,
TransferFeeInitialize,
},
};
#[derive(Accounts)]
pub struct Initialize<'info> {
#[account(mut)]
pub payer: Signer<'info>,
#[account(mut)]
pub mint_account: Signer<'info>,
pub token_program: Program<'info, Token2022>,
pub system_program: Program<'info, System>,
}
pub fn initialize_transfer_fee_config(
ctx: Context<Initialize>,
transfer_fee_basis_points: u16,
maximum_fee: u64,
) -> Result<()> {
// Calculate space required for mint and extension data
let mint_size =
ExtensionType::try_calculate_account_len::<PodMint>(&[ExtensionType::TransferFeeConfig])?;
// Calculate minimum lamports required for size of mint account with extensions
let lamports = (Rent::get()?).minimum_balance(mint_size);
// Invoke System Program to create new account with space for mint and extension data
create_account(
CpiContext::new(
ctx.accounts.system_program.to_account_info(),
CreateAccount {
from: ctx.accounts.payer.to_account_info(),
to: ctx.accounts.mint_account.to_account_info(),
},
),
lamports, // Lamports
mint_size as u64, // Space
&ctx.accounts.token_program.key(), // Owner Program
)?;
// Initialize the transfer fee extension data
// This instruction must come before the instruction to initialize the mint data
transfer_fee_initialize(
CpiContext::new(
ctx.accounts.token_program.to_account_info(),
TransferFeeInitialize {
token_program_id: ctx.accounts.token_program.to_account_info(),
mint: ctx.accounts.mint_account.to_account_info(),
},
),
Some(&ctx.accounts.payer.key()), // transfer fee config authority (update fee)
Some(&ctx.accounts.payer.key()), // withdraw authority (withdraw fees)
transfer_fee_basis_points, // transfer fee basis points (% fee per transfer)
maximum_fee, // maximum fee (maximum units of token per transfer)
)?;
// Initialize the standard mint account data
initialize_mint2(
CpiContext::new(
ctx.accounts.token_program.to_account_info(),
InitializeMint2 {
mint: ctx.accounts.mint_account.to_account_info(),
},
),
2, // decimals
&ctx.accounts.payer.key(), // mint authority
Some(&ctx.accounts.payer.key()), // freeze authority
)?;
Ok(())

要轉移具有 TransferFee 擴展的 Mint 代幣,我們有兩種路徑:
我們可以使用普通的
transfer_checked()指令,這樣費用的計算會自動處理我們可以使用
transfer_checked_with_fee()指令並手動提供我們在該轉移中要支付的fee。這在我們想確保不被「詐騙」時非常有用,例如當授權更改費用並設置異常高的費用時;這就像為轉移設置滑點。
以下是如何使用 transfer_checked_with_fee() 指令創建轉移的方法:
use anchor_lang::prelude::*;
use anchor_spl::{
associated_token::AssociatedToken,
token_2022::spl_token_2022::{
extension::{
transfer_fee::TransferFeeConfig, BaseStateWithExtensions, StateWithExtensions,
},
state::Mint as MintState,
},
token_interface::{
transfer_checked_with_fee, Mint, Token2022, TokenAccount, TransferCheckedWithFee,
},
};
#[derive(Accounts)]
pub struct Transfer<'info> {
#[account(mut)]
pub sender: Signer<'info>,
pub recipient: SystemAccount<'info>,
#[account(mut)]
pub mint_account: InterfaceAccount<'info, Mint>,
#[account(
mut,
associated_token::mint = mint_account,
associated_token::authority = sender,
associated_token::token_program = token_program
)]
pub sender_token_account: InterfaceAccount<'info, TokenAccount>,
#[account(
init_if_needed,
payer = sender,
associated_token::mint = mint_account,
associated_token::authority = recipient,
associated_token::token_program = token_program
)]
pub recipient_token_account: InterfaceAccount<'info, TokenAccount>,
pub token_program: Program<'info, Token2022>,
pub associated_token_program: Program<'info, AssociatedToken>,
pub system_program: Program<'info, System>,
}
// transfer fees are automatically deducted from the transfer amount
// recipients receives (transfer amount - fees)
// transfer fees are stored directly on the recipient token account and must be "harvested"
pub fn transfer_checked_with_fee(ctx: Context<Transfer>, amount: u64) -> Result<()> {
// read mint account extension data
let mint = &ctx.accounts.mint_account.to_account_info();
let mint_data = mint.data.borrow();
let mint_with_extension = StateWithExtensions::<MintState>::unpack(&mint_data)?;
let extension_data = mint_with_extension.get_extension::<TransferFeeConfig>()?;
// calculate expected fee
let epoch = Clock::get()?.epoch;
let fee = extension_data.calculate_epoch_fee(epoch, amount).unwrap();
// mint account decimals
let decimals = ctx.accounts.mint_account.decimals;
transfer_checked_with_fee(
CpiContext::new(
ctx.accounts.token_program.to_account_info(),
TransferCheckedWithFee {
token_program_id: ctx.accounts.token_program.to_account_info(),
source: ctx.accounts.sender_token_account.to_account_info(),
mint: ctx.accounts.mint_account.to_account_info(),
destination: ctx.accounts.recipient_token_account.to_account_info(),
authority: ctx.accounts.sender.to_account_info(),
},
),
amount, // transfer amount
decimals, // decimals
fee, // fee
)?;
Ok(())

在我們使用TranferFee擴展初始化了Mint之後,未來可能需要更新該特定費用。為了確保創建者不會通過設置非常高的費用來「誘餌欺詐」代幣持有人,每次執行轉賬時,新TranferFee將在2個epoch後啟用。
為了適應這一點,以下是TransferFee擴展的數據結構:
pub struct TransferFeeConfig {
pub transfer_fee_config_authority: Pubkey,
pub withdraw_withheld_authority: Pubkey,
pub withheld_amount: u64,
pub older_transfer_fee: TransferFee,
pub newer_transfer_fee: TransferFee,
}
pub struct TransferFee {
pub epoch: u64,
pub maximum_fee: u64,
pub transfer_fee_basis_point: u16,
